Installing Minecraft on consoles

Discussing storage requirements for popular gaming consoles (PlayStation, Xbox, Nintendo Switch)

When it comes to playing Minecraft on gaming consoles such as PlayStation, Xbox, and Nintendo Switch, understanding the storage requirements is essential. Each console has its own specifications, and knowing the space needed for installation ensures a smooth gaming experience.

The base game file size for Minecraft on consoles can vary depending on the edition and version. On average, the size ranges from 200 to 400 MB. However, it is important to note that this is just the initial installation size and does not include updates, patches, or additional content.

Space needed for digital downloads versus physical copies of the game may differ. Digital downloads require more storage space as they include the installation file and the game data. For example, on PlayStation 4 and Xbox One, a digital copy of Minecraft can occupy around 1.5 to 2GB of storage space. On the other hand, physical copies only require enough space to install the game initially, and any updates or patches can be downloaded separately.

Space needed for digital downloads vs. physical copies

Digital downloads offer convenience, as they eliminate the need for physical media. However, they require more storage space due to including both the installation file and game data. Physical copies, on the other hand, usually require less space initially, but additional storage will be needed for updates and patches.

For example, on PlayStation 4, the Minecraft physical copy requires approximately 300MB for installation, but updates and patches can add up to an additional 1.8GB or more. Similarly, on Xbox One, the initial installation size is around 200MB, but updates can take up several gigabytes of storage.

Nintendo Switch, being a hybrid console, has its own storage requirements. The base game size for Minecraft on the Switch is around 430MB for the digital version and 350MB for the physical version. However, players should keep in mind that additional space may be required for updates and patches.

Installing Minecraft on Mobile Devices

Minecraft, the immensely popular sandbox game developed by Mojang Studios, has captivated millions of players worldwide with its endless possibilities and creative gameplay. As the game continues to evolve and expand with updates and additional content, it is crucial for players to understand the storage requirements for installing and playing Minecraft on different devices. This section delves into the considerations and storage requirements for mobile devices, specifically iOS and Android.

Storage Considerations for iOS and Android Devices

Installing Minecraft on mobile devices brings its own set of storage considerations. The storage requirements for Minecraft on iOS and Android vary based on the platform and device specifications.

The size of the Minecraft app itself is relatively small. On iOS, the app size ranges from around 300MB to 400MB, depending on the version. Android devices, on the other hand, have a slightly larger app size, usually ranging from 400MB to 500MB. It is important to note that these sizes are for the base game, and additional content can significantly increase the storage requirements.

In addition to the app size, Minecraft also requires additional storage for game data and saves. When playing the game, data such as world saves, texture packs, and player skins accumulate over time. These files are stored on the device’s internal storage or SD card in the case of Android devices.

Minecraft’s game data can take up a considerable amount of storage space, especially for players who actively explore, build, and create within the game. It is advisable to regularly backup and manage game data to prevent storage issues and ensure smooth gameplay.

Managing Storage Space for Optimal Performance

To optimize storage space on iOS and Android devices for Minecraft, there are several tips and tricks to follow. Clearing the game’s cache periodically can free up storage space and potentially improve performance. This can be done by going into the device’s settings, locating the Minecraft app, and selecting the option to clear cache.

Another effective approach is to move Minecraft’s game data, such as world saves and texture packs, to external storage if supported by the device. This can be achieved by utilizing external storage solutions like microSD cards on Android devices.

Regularly reviewing and deleting unnecessary files or worlds that are no longer in use is also recommended. This allows for better management of storage space and ensures that the game runs smoothly without any storage-related issues.

Mobile devices:

iOS and Android devices have different options for storage upgrades. On iOS devices, storage cannot be upgraded externally, as Apple does not support external storage devices. However, users can consider upgrading to a device with higher internal storage capacity. Android devices, on the other hand, do support external storage options, such as microSD cards. By inserting a microSD card with higher capacity, players can expand their storage for Minecraft and other applications.
